Samuel Taylor Coleridge (1772 --- 1834)

Born --- in a priest family

Family --- his father died when he was only 3.

Character --- lonely, but filled with dreams

Education --- Charity School of Christ’s Hospital

In Cambridge for 3 years without a degree

Kubla Khan

Collected in Lyrical Ballads

unfinished poem of 54 lines

He claimed that one day in his dream he composed a poem of 200—300 lines when he was taking a nap.

He was interrupted by an unexpected guest and stopped at 54 lines.

His life

*He was born with a club – foot and became extreme sensitivity about his lameness.

*In Cambridge, he piled up debts and aroused alarm with bisexual love affairs.

*In 1815, he married and had a daughter. But the marriage was unhappy, and they separated next year.

Page 9: Samuel Taylor Coleridge (1772 --- 1834) Born --- in a priest family Family --- his father died when he was only 3. Character --- lonely, but filled with

* In 1816, he left England because of the rumors, and never returned.

* He settled in Geneva with Shelley and his lover.

* He sailed to Greece, but he was contracted a fever from which he died.

John Keats (1795 --- 1821)

Born ----- on October 31, 1795 in London

Family ----- father : a livery – stable keeper

At 8 years old his father died, and his mother died when he was 14.

Education ----- at Clarke’s School in Enfield

His guardian forced him to leave school and apprenticed him to a surgeon.

Charles Lamb (1775 --- 1834)

Born ----- in London , 1775

Education ---- at Christ’s Hospital, where he formed a lifelong friendship with Coleridge

Illness ----- when he was 20 he suffered a period of insanity.

Marriage ----- never married

His sister, Mary, had similar problems and in 1796 murdered her mother in a fit of madness.
